Understanding Ignition Systems
Before diving into repair services, it's necessary to comprehend what an ignition system requires. An ignition system is a basic part of an internal combustion engine, accountable for igniting the air-fuel mixture to produce power. Usually, the ignition system includes:
Ignition Coil: Converts battery voltage to the required voltage to create a spark.Stimulate Plugs: Ignite the air-fuel mix in the combustion chamber.Distributor: Distributes high voltage from the ignition coil to the correct cylinder.Ignition Module: Controls the timing of the stimulate.Common Ignition System Issues

Engine Won't Start: One of the most visible indications of ignition difficulty is when your lorry stops working to start. If you turn the key and hear nothing or just click, it may indicate a defective ignition system.
Stalling: If your car stalls while driving, particularly after beginning without issues, it could represent an underlying ignition system issue.
Poor Acceleration: Hesitation in velocity or loss of power can indicate that the engine is not firing on all cylinders, often linked to spark plug or ignition coil faults.
Control Panel Warning Lights: Some vehicles will display alerting lights on the control panel if the ignition system is malfunctioning. Always examine these notifications instantly.
Frequent Misfires: If you discover your engine misfiring, it can lead to increased emissions and decreased fuel performance, providing a clear requirement for evaluation.
